Output stage of channel 1 17.5.5 Forced output mode In output mode (CCiS bits = 0b00 in the TIMx_CCMRi register) where i is the channel number, each output compare signal can be forced to high or low level directly by software, independently of any comparison between the output compare register and the counter. To force an output compare signal to its active level, you just need to write ‘101’ in the OCiM bits in the corresponding TIMx_CCMRi register. Thus OCiREF is forced high (OCiREF is always active high) and the OCi output is forced to high or low level depending on the CCiP polarity bit. For example: CCiP=0 (OCi active high) => OCi is forced to high level. The OCiREF signal can be forced low by writing the OCiM bits to 0b100 in the TIMx_CCMRx register. Anyway, the comparison between the TIMx_CCRi shadow register and the counter is still performed and allows the flag to be set. Interrupt requests can be sent accordingly. This is described in the Output Compare Mode section below. 17.5.6 Output compare mode This function is used to control an output waveform or indicate when a period of time has elapsed. When a match is found between the capture/compare register and the counter: • Depending on the output compare mode, the corresponding OCi output pin: – keeps its level (OCiM=0b000), – is set active (OCiM=0b001), – is set inactive (OCiM=0b010) – or toggles (OCiM=0b011) • Sets a flag in the interrupt status register (CCiIF bit in the TIMx_SR1 register). • Generates an interrupt if the corresponding interrupt mask is set (CCiIE bit in the TIMx_IER register). The output compare mode is defined by the OCiM bits in the TIMx_CCMRi register. The active or inactive level polarity is defined by the CCiP bit in the TIMx_CCERi register.
